Maltese countryside has so much to offer, from spectacular views and incredible flora and fauna, and this story proves just that. Locals were enjoying their Sunday stroll in Zurrieq when they spotted the cutest thing ever!

This little ferret popped by to say hello in Wied Babu Road and enjoyed the photo op, of course! The photogenic creature climbed up on the rocks to enjoy the gorgeous views, while also playing a little hide and seek with the locals who spotted him. How adorbs!

People were shocked and a little confused as to what this little guy was doing since ferrets aren't generally spotted in the wild, being a domestic animal. Ferrets are not to be confused with the Maltese weasel (ballotra) which is generally spotted in the countryside. We hope the little dude is ok and finds his way back home soon!
